ESEE Izula with stock sheath dumped in the pocket. Not ideal for high speed tactical unsheathing, but it’s there when I need it. The Izula won’t let you down.
 
New favorite small fixed blade EDC. 14c28n, fantastic sheath, sub $50. Ruike F815-B. I've had it about a month. Haven't carried it outside the house much for obvious reasons but have used it a bunch around the house and yard. The 14c28n zips through cardboard and holds an edge really well.

I don't carry it everyday, but a few days a week my BM 162 has been on my hip for the past 4-5 years. Its very handy around the farm, and has held up remarkably well. Was my first S30V knife and I can get that knife sharper than anything else I own.
